A robbery investigation in western Wisconsin briefly prompted a school lockdown Thursday morning.
Police in Cornell responded to Citizens State Bank just before 10 a.m. As a precaution, nearby schools were placed on lockdown while officers secured the scene. Authorities say 40-year-old Kevin Rassmussen, of Woodville, was taken into custody on a charge of attempted robbery. The lockdown has since been lifted, and officials say this was an isolated incident with no ongoing threat to the public.
